Responsibilities: Selected candidate will routinely have the opportunity to utilize all of their training and advance their skill set in areas such as:
- Supporting our veterinarians to ensure quality veterinary care, advocating for our patients, and educating our clients.
- Obtaining relevant health history and information from clients and maintaining medical charts.
- Administration of injections, as well as performing venipunctures, and setting IV catheters.
- Use safe restraining techniques, follow standard protocols, and sustain clean, sterile, organized treatment areas, exam rooms, and labs.
- Dentistry skills including cleaning, probing, charting teeth as well as oral radiology. Assisting the veterinarian in oral surgery.
- Utilizing multiple radiographic techniques; positioning knowledge.
- Familiarity and proper use of cold laser therapy techniques.
- Taking vital signs of patients, under minimal supervision.
- Preparing patients, medications, and equipment for surgery, as well as sedation and anesthesia preparation. In addition, monitoring of patient's pre, during and post-procedure during recovery.
- Assisting the veterinarian during surgical procedures - handing instruments, materials to the Doctor.
- Performs routine laboratory tests and prepares samples for reference lab.
- Assisting with emergent or specialized patient care.
- Provide counseling for clients and deliver compassionate nursing care.
- Be willing to guide, mentor, and support fellow team members.
